NASA budget would ramp up asteroid mission

The Obama administration's proposal for funding NASA in fiscal 2015 is based partly on assumptions that Republican lawmakers in Congress are sure to contest.

 

Ledyard King - USA TODAY

 

NASA's proposed budget for fiscal 2015 would ramp up funding to fly astronauts to an asteroid by 2025 as part of a steppingstone approach to Mars, a mission some lawmakers want to replace with a return trip to the moon.

 

The $133 million for the mission, which would deflect a small asteroid into near-Earth orbit so astronauts could practice landing on it and study its characteristics, is part of the space agency's proposed $17.46 billion budget released by the administration Tuesday.

 

Fiscal 2015 begins on Oct. 1 and ends on Sept. 30, 2015.

 

The budget also includes funding to continue NASA's other top priorities: a deep-space Space Launch System rocket and the Orion multi-purpose vehicle it will carry to Mars, the James Webb Space Telescope due for launch in 2018, and the Commercial Crew Program that helps fund private efforts to send astronauts from the U.S. to the International Space Station.

 

The budget is about $185 million below the fiscal 2014 level but roughly $600 million more than NASA received in fiscal 2013, when sequestration cut discretionary spending across the board.

 

NASA could have access to another $900 million as well — its share of a $56 billion Opportunity, Growth and Security Initiative that would be separate from the regular budget.

 

NASA administrator says Americans and Russians still getting along fine in space

Joel Achenbach – The Washington Post

There's a place where the United States and Russia are still getting along swimmingly: About 250 miles above the surface of the Earth, where three Russians, two Americans and an astronaut from Japan are aboard the international space station.

"Everything is nominal right now with our relationship with the Russians," said NASA administrator Charles Bolden during a teleconference Tuesday.

With the space shuttle retired, the U.S. relies on Russia's Soyuz spacecraft to get to and from the space station. Russia charges about $71 million per seat. There is no other way for American astronauts to get back to Earth.

Tuesday's teleconference was set up to allow Bolden to discuss the White House's Fiscal Year 2015 budget request, but he wound up fielding numerous inquiries from reporters about whether the Ukraine crisis has affected NASA's strategic planning.

No, Bolden said repeatedly. He noted that past flare-ups between the U.S. and Russia have not affected operations in space.

"We have weathered the storm through lots of contingencies here," Bolden said.

He told a personal story: In 1994 he commanded the first joint U.S.-Russia space shuttle mission. He said that, "because of my training as a Marine," he wasn't entirely comfortable at first with the idea of teaming up with the Russians, but then during the planning stages for the mission he got to know Russian cosmonaut Sergei Krikalev and his Russian backup.

Russia, the U.S., Europe, Canada and Japan jointly operate the ISS, which the Obama administration wants to continue funding at least through 2024, a four-year extension. Whether the international partners will extend their participation beyond 2020 is unclear at this point.

After the teleconference, NASA spokesman Bob Jacobs e-mailed an elaboration on Bolden's comments:

"NASA and its Russian counterpart, Roscosmos, have maintained a professional, beneficial, and collegial working relationship through the various ups and downs of the broader U.S.-Russia relationship and we expect that to continue throughout the life of the ISS program and beyond.

"NASA is moving toward awarding contracts this year to private American companies to send our astronauts to the International Space Station, keeping the agency on target to launch American astronauts from the U.S. by 2017 and ending our reliance on Russia to get into space."

The administration has repeatedly stressed that the "commercial crew" program needs to be fully funded by Congress if the 2017 target is going to be met. But NASA's budget has been squeezed for several years, having peaked at $18.7 billion in 2010.

Obama's budget request asks for just under $17.5 billion for NASA in 2015, a decrease of $186 million from what Congress allotted the agency in FY2014.

Bolden said the budget keeps NASA moving full speed ahead: "This budget keeps us on the same, steady path we have been following – a stepping stone approach to send humans to Mars in the 2030's."

The administration's budget would trim $180 billion from the science program. A prominent casualty is the Stratospheric Observatory for Infrared Astronomy (SOFIA), a jumbo jet that will wind up being warehoused unless funding somehow materializes.

The administration wants $133 for the controversial Asteroid Redirect Mission, in which a robotic vehicle would either grab a small asteroid or break a chunk off a bigger one and then haul it back to lunar orbit.

Popular science missions such as Cassini, the probe orbiting Saturn, and Curiosity, the rover on Mars, will stay alive under the president's budget, and the modest sum of $15 million will go toward early planning for a possible robotic mission to Jupiter's intriguing moon Europa, which appears to have a subsurface ocean. Engineers think a mission to study Europa would cost upward of $2 billion, but Bolden and his deputies in recent months have said there's no money in the near future for such big-ticket "Flagship" missions.

Boosters of planetary science were unhappy Tuesday that the overall planetary-science budget request is only $1.28 billion, a modest boost over last year's budget request but still less than what Congress appropriated for 2014. Advocates have argued that planetary science ought to have a $1.5 billion budget — as it did a few years ago.

"It's still plainly insufficient to maintain America's leadership in planetary science," said Rep. Adam Schiff (D.-Calif.), who represents Pasadena, home to the NASA Jet Propulsion Laboratory.

Obama eyes boost in space taxi spending, Jupiter moon mission

Irene Klotz – Reuters

 

President Barack Obama's 2015 NASA budget plan includes funding for a robotic mission to an ocean-bearing moon of Jupiter and could help boost commercial ventures to fly astronauts to the International Space Station, NASA officials said on Tuesday.

The White House is requesting a $17.5 billion budget for the U.S. space agency in the fiscal year that begins Oct. 1.

That marks a 1 percent decrease from NASA's 2014 budget. But NASA could also have access to an additional $900 million from Obama's proposed Opportunity, Growth and Security Initiative, a $56 billion fund for special projects that is separate from the regular budget.

If approved, the agency would have $1.1 billion next year to help at least two companies develop commercial space taxis to fly astronauts to and from the space station. The $100 billion research outpost, a project of 15 nations, flies about 260 miles (420 km) above Earth.

Since the space shuttles were retired in 2011, the United States is dependent on Russia to fly crews to the space station at a cost of more than $65 million a seat.

For now, escalating U.S. tensions with Russia over the crisis in Ukraine have not affected the space partnership, NASA Administrator Charles Bolden told reporters on a conference call.

"We are continuing to monitor the situation," Bolden said. "Right now, everything is normal in our relationship with the Russians," he said.

Currently, NASA is supporting space taxi designs by Boeing Co, privately owned Space Exploration Technologies and privately owned Sierra Nevada Corp.

The agency intends to select at least two companies for a final round of development funding this summer. Obama wants to have U.S. options for flying astronauts to the station before the end of 2017.

The so-called Commercial Crew program is receiving $696 million for the 2014 fiscal year ending September 30. The proposed funding increase would add as much as $400 million to the program for fiscal 2015.

The new budget also includes $3.1 billion for NASA to operate the station and provides $2.8 billion to continue development of the Space Launch System heavy-lift rocket and Orion capsule for future human missions to the moon, asteroids and Mars. An unmanned Orion test flight is scheduled for Sept. 18.

One of the first operational Orion missions would send astronauts to an asteroid that has been robotically relocated into a high orbit around the moon. Planning for the so-called Asteroid Redirect Mission gets a boost to $133 million in the 2015 budget proposal, up from $78 million in 2014.

As currently envisioned, hiking spending on the asteroid initiative means cutbacks in other programs, warns the Coalition for Space Exploration, a Houston-based industry advocacy organization.

"We remain concerned and opposed to the annual effort to drain funds from our nation's exploration programs," the group said in a statement.

Science missions would share nearly $5 billion in 2015, including $15 million to begin planning for a mid-2020s mission to Europa, an ice-encrusted moon of Jupiter.

Scientists have strong evidence that the moon has a vast ocean beneath its frozen surface. Water is believed to be essential for life.

"It's one of those places where life might occur, in the past or now, and so we're really excited about going there," said NASA's Chief Financial Officer Beth Robinson.

The proposed budget keeps the Hubble Space Telescope successor program - an infrared observatory known as the James Webb Space Telescope - on track for launch in 2018. It also lets NASA begin planning for a new telescope to probe the mysterious force known as "dark energy" that is driving the universe apart at faster and faster rates.

White House budget proposal would mean stability for NASA in Alabama in 2015

Lee Roop – Huntsville Times

Here's a look in seven numbers and two quotes at President Obama's 2015 budget proposal as it affects NASA's major Alabama center, the Marshall Space Flight Center.

First, a quote from Marshall Director Patrick Scheuermann: "This is a good budget for Marshall Space Flight Center and it provides stability for our workforce, programs and projects."

Next, the numbers:

$2.15 billion - the share of the president's $17.5 billion NASA budget request that comes to Marshall. It's about the same as last year.

$1.4 billion - the amount the center will spend developing the heavy-lift rocket called the Space Launch System next year. It's also "consistent with last year," Scheuermann said.

$193 million - the amount budgeted for space operations at Marshall. The big item here is the Payload Operations Center where Marshall manages all science experiments aboard the International Space Station. That's a 24/7/365 operation.

$41 million - the amount budgeted for Marshall's technology work including its centennial challenges and similar programs.

$140 million - the amount budgeted for science at Marshall including solar research, climate research, meteoroid research and other programs.

$71 million - the amount budgeted for construction and revitalization on the center in 2015.

1 - the number of new buildings Marshall will open in FY 2015. It's also the number of buildings Marshall will close and tear down and the number of historic buildings the center will finish refurbishing.

0 - The chance this White House budget will pass Congress as it stands now. Both houses will add here, cut there and eventually pass a budget.

Finally, a second quote: Asked if Marshall's $140 million science budget request is an increase, a cut or about the same as this year, center financial officer Bill Hicks said the numbers are still flowing down from NASA Headquarters but, "Our science budget tends to run pretty flat, so we expect it to be there."

Sand Springs native, Skylab astronaut Bill Pogue dies at 84

Tim Stanley – Tulsa World

William R. "Bill" Pogue, a former astronaut and retired Air Force colonel from Sand Springs who was the pilot for the third and final Skylab space station mission, died Tuesday at his home in Florida, family members said. He was 84.

Funeral services are pending.

Pogue, together with astronauts Gerald Carr and Edward Gibson, spent 84 consecutive days in space from 1973 to 1974 aboard Skylab, the first American space station.

Their 12 weeks in orbit was a record at the time, topping the previous Skylab mission's eight weeks. They orbited the earth 1,214 times while aboard the station, traveling 35.5 million miles

Pogue made two space walks during the mission.

Born Jan. 23, 1930, in Okemah, Pogue grew up in Sand Springs.

After graduating from Sand Springs High School in 1947, he entered the Air Force, beginning what would be a distinguished 25-year career.

Among the highlights, he was a combat fighter pilot in Korea and later spent two years as an aerobatic pilot with the Air Force's Thunderbirds.

In 1966, Pogue was among the applicants selected by NASA for the space program.

Pogue held a bachelor's degree in education from Oklahoma Baptist University and a master's in mathematics from Oklahoma State University.

Among his many awards and citations, he was inducted into the U.S. Astronaut Hall of Fame in 1997.

The William R. Pogue Municipal Airport in Sand Springs is named for him.

Pogue enjoyed speaking at schools, and one of the most common questions he was asked led to a book. Now in its third edition, Pogue's "How Do You Go to the Bathroom in Space?" answers that and many other of the queries he fielded from curious children and adults.

Orbital Sciences Examining 2-3 Russian Alternatives to Antares' AJ-26 Engine

Peter B. de Selding – Space News

Orbital Sciences is investigating "two or three alternatives," all of them Russian, to the current AJ-26 engine that powers the company's Antares rocket, Orbital Chief Financial Officer Garrett E. Pierce said March 3.

Orbital's exploration includes filing suit against United Launch Alliance of Colorado in an attempt to break ULA's exclusivity contract with the makers of Russia's RD-180 engine, which powers the first stage of ULA's Atlas 5 rocket.

In a presentation to a conference organized by Raymond James investment advisers, Pierce said Dulles, Va.-based Orbital and its suppliers have enough AJ-26 engines to complete Orbital's Commercial Resupply Services (CRS) space station cargo-supply contract with NASA, which totals eight Antares missions, and several additional missions as well. NASA is preparing to solicit bids for a follow-on contract that would call for four to five flights a year between 2017 and 2024.

"Right now we are exploring the various avenues that could be available to the company to continue to use the AJ-26 or to use other rocket systems — Russian-sourced systems — we're looking at right now," Pierce said. "There are two or three alternatives. Right now the AJ-26 is the standard rocket [engine] that we use on the Antares for the [CRS] contract and a bit beyond that. Then we'll have the option — this is a few years out — to change the system or continue with it."

ISS Finds Niche as Important, if Imperfect, Earth Observation Platform

Space News Editor

The emergence of the international space station as a go-to host platform for Earth observing sensors is testimony to the resourcefulness of NASA and the Earth science community during a time of scarcity.

The massive orbiting outpost already hosts a handful of downward-looking sensors, both government and commercially owned. Examples include the U.S. government-developed Hyperspectral Imager for the Coastal Environment and a pair of commercial imaging cameras — one for taking full-motion video — operated by UrtheCast, a for-profit company. 

NASA plans to install at least five more environmental instruments during the next four years. Among them are space-based versions of sensors previously flown only on aircraft and instruments that will build on existing records of satellite-collected environmental data.

The push to utilize station for Earth science can be viewed from one of two different perspectives. As a readily available platform with ample onboard space and power resources, the station is an ideal, low-cost test bed for new technologies and measurements that are candidates for future dedicated satellite missions. Alternatively, but for the same reasons, the station might be seen as an option of last resort for NASA's Earth Science Division, whose ability to build and launch dedicated satellites, even to collect measurements of proven scientific value, is severely limited by budget pressures. As Michael Freilich, the division's director, recently noted, the launch — and in some cases the development — costs for station-hosted instruments are covered by that program's budget.

It's true that the station is in many ways less than ideal as a platform for Earth observation, especially if the objective is scientific research, as opposed to technology demonstration.  Station's orbit is inclined at 56 degrees relative to the equator, whereas most Earth observing satellites operate in polar, sun-synchronous orbits that provide global coverage and pass over a given point on Earth at the same time each day. In addition, the altitude of the station's orbit varies widely, and data collection is frequently interrupted during events such as orbit raising maneuvers and the arrival of crew- and cargo-carrying spacecraft.

On the brighter side, some research applications are best suited to relatively low-inclination orbits. Moreover, station-hosted sensors, because they pass over the same spots on Earth at different times of day, can complement the data collected from sun-synchronous orbit.

Given its estimated $100 billion-plus price tag, the international space station could never be justified on the basis of its ability to support environmental or climate-change research.  But the station is available, underutilized and has a logistics and research budget that can support any number of NASA science activities. Station managers are doing all the right things to encourage potential users, government and commercial, to take advantage. That the Earth Science Division is taking that offer to heart, in much the same way as it is making the most of hosted payload opportunities aboard commercial telecommunications spacecraft, is to its credit.

Climate engineering ideas no longer considered pie in the sky

Scientists backed by the government and Bill Gates are studying schemes such as sunlight-blocking particles and giant carbon vacuums to halt climate change.

Evan Halper – Los Angeles Times

As international efforts to reduce greenhouse gas emissions stall, schemes to slow global warming using fantastical technologies once dismissed as a sideshow are getting serious consideration in Washington.

Ships that spew salt into the air to block sunlight. Mirrored satellites designed to bounce solar rays back into space. Massive "reverse" power plants that would suck carbon from the atmosphere. These are among the ideas the National Academy of Sciences has charged a panel of some of the nation's top climate thinkers to investigate. Several agencies requested the inquiry, including the CIA.

At the Jet Propulsion Laboratory in La Cañada Flintridge, scientists are modeling what such technologies might do to weather patterns. At the Pacific Northwest National Laboratory in Richland, Wash., a fund created by Microsoft founder Bill Gates — an enthusiast of research into climate engineering — helps bankroll another such effort.

"There is a level of seriousness about these strategies that didn't exist a decade ago, when it was considered just a game," said Ken Caldeira, a scientist with the Carnegie Institution at Stanford University, who sits on the National Academy of Sciences panel. "Attitudes have changed dramatically."

Even as the research moves forward, many scientists and government officials worry about the risks of massive climate-control contraptions.

Some fear the potential for error in tampering with the world's thermostat. Get it wrong, they say, and the consequences could be disastrous.

Many also say the public could develop a false hope that geo-engineering schemes alone could halt climate change. That, they worry, would undermine already tenuous support for efforts to seriously reduce emissions of carbon dioxide and other gases that contribute to warming the climate.

Even so, once-skeptical federal officials and scientists at major research institutions including Stanford, Harvard and Caltech have decided that ignoring these largely untested technologies also poses dangers.

"There has been so little movement globally and, particularly, nationally toward mitigation of climate change that we're in a situation where we need to know what the prospects are for this," said Marcia McNutt, a former director of the U.S. Geological Survey, who is chairwoman of the National Academy of Sciences panel.

"Whether we wind up using these technologies, or someone else does and we suddenly find ourselves in a geo-engineered world, we have to better understand the impacts and the consequences," she said.

Agencies are struggling to analyze the possibilities of weather control and how it might be policed. In November, the Congressional Research Service advised lawmakers to pay attention to the issue, saying "these new technologies may become available to foreign governments and entities in the private sector to use unilaterally — without authorization from the United States government or an international treaty."

That already happened to a limited extent in mid-2012 when a California businessman, Russ George, dumped 200,000 pounds of iron-rich dust off the coast of British Columbia, Canada, in an effort — many say publicity stunt — aimed at spurring a massive plankton bloom.

The theory of ocean fertilization holds that more plankton would increase the ocean's capacity to absorb carbon from the atmosphere. George's test did appear to cause more plankton to bloom, but it is unclear whether it had any effect on carbon dioxide levels in the air.

That same year, British scientists canceled plans to test the effect that spraying liquids at high altitude would have on sunlight. The proposed small-scale test involved launching a balloon high above the sea and spraying what would have amounted to a couple of bathtubs of water into the atmosphere. In theory, that would mimic the cooling effect that occurs when ash from a volcanic eruption blocks sunlight.

The experiment was grounded amid a heated dispute, which continues today, over whether field tests should be taking place at all in the absence of international rules guiding how to go about them. Some prominent climate experts have argued that the technology the British scientists were testing, were it ever to be used on a large scale, could exacerbate extreme drought and flooding in parts of the world.

"We need to consider whether we have the right legal architecture in place to make sure bad things don't happen," said Harvard law professor Jody Freeman, a former White House counselor for energy and climate change. "It is important we have some control and society is engaged in the risks."

The technologies being proposed are numerous, and often odd.

"I have seen all kinds of proposals," said James Fleming, author of "Fixing the Sky: The Checkered History of Weather and Climate Control" and a member of the National Academy geo-engineering committee.

"There is a crazy new one in my email every week," he said. "There are a lot of Rube Goldbergs out there, and some Dr. Strangeloves."

Of the technologies being considered, those that would remove carbon tend to be less controversial. Riley Duren, chief systems engineer for Earth science and technology at the Jet Propulsion Laboratory, estimates, for example, that counteracting today's emissions would require about 30,000 of what he calls reverse power plants: enormous steel structures developed by a start-up in Calgary, Canada, that would use fans to suck carbon dioxide out of the atmosphere.

IG report finds flaws in NASA's mobile device management

Frank Konkel – Federal Computer Week

 

NASA is not doing a good job managing its mobile devices, according to a new report authored by NASA Inspector General Paul Martin.

The space agency's mismanagement of its 16,900 agency-issued tablets, smartphones, cell phones and AirCards came with a hefty price tag for taxpayers in 2013. About 2,300, or 14 percent of all agency-issued devices, went unused for seven months while costing taxpayers $679,000, according to the report.

The report attributes the waste to "weaknesses in NASA's mobile device management practices," primarily its lack of a "complete and accurate inventory of agency-issued mobile devices." The IG explains that the information system NASA uses to order mobile devices from its primary IT contractor, HP Enterprise Services, "Is not fully functional or integrated with the database the agency uses to track IT assets."

This is the second time in as many months that significant IT issues have surfaced between NASA and HP Enterprise Services.

In January, the NASA IG released a report outlining "significant problems" in its $2.5 billion Agency Consolidated End-User Services (ACES) contract with HP Enterprise Services, which is expected to provide NASA with desktops, laptops, mobile devices, computer equipment and end-user services. The report came midway through the contract's four-year base period, and NASA officials said it was still evaluating whether to exercise the contract's option. When reached by FCW, a NASA official said the agency had no further comment on whether it would exercise the option.

With regards to the poor mobile-device management, the IG puts the blame on both parties.

"Neither NASA nor HP has an accurate inventory of Agency-issued mobile devices. NASA officials admitted they had no authoritative database of these devices and were not confident that HP could accurately account for the full inventory of mobile devices it provides to the Agency," the new report states. "The lack of a complete inventory adversely affects NASA's ability to verify the accuracy and completeness of ACES invoices and leaves the Agency susceptible to paying erroneous or excessive charges."

In its latest report, the IG also found that NASA has significant information security risks to address. The agency improved the secure means by which its mobile devices connected to NASA email systems in 2013, but with locations around the country, NASA still has vulnerabilities across its multitude of networks, including the wireless local networks at its centers.

Not surprisingly, the IG recommended NASA improve its methods for tracking agency-issued mobile devices and that the agency implement a centralized mobile device management capability. NASA CIO Larry Sweet, in the process of trying to centralize his authority over NASA's IT spending, signed off on both recommendations.

JSC Special: Morpheus Free Flight 8 Today at Kennedy Space Center

Today, weather permitting, the Morpheus team plans another free flight test at Kennedy Space Center. The test will be streamed live on JSC's UStream Channel. View the live stream, along with progress updates sent via Twitter, on the website. Or, if you're on-site, watch live on JSC HDTV (channel 51-2) and IPTV (channel 4512).

 

During this test, the autonomous untethered Morpheus "Bravo" vehicle will launch from the ground over the flame trench, ascend approximately 142 meters, then translate approximately 194 meters downrange while performing a 17-meter divert to emulate a hazard avoidance maneuver before descending to land on a pad in the hazard field. Test firing is planned for approximately 9:45 a.m. CST and will last around 82 seconds. Streaming will begin approximately 20 minutes prior to ignition.

A newly declassified military space program will place satellites on the lookout for threats to national-security spacecraft high above Earth.

Four satellites launched in pairs, the first late this year from Cape Canaveral on a Delta IV rocket, will provide new eyes on exactly what is flying in geosynchronous orbit 22,300 miles up.

And should an adversary's spacecraft move too close to U.S. assets — to learn more about them or potentially launch an orbital attack — the action won't go unnoticed.

"The U.S. military has some very important national security satellites out there performing a range of missions, and they're worried about being able to protect those satellites, particularly against any kind of hostile action," said Brian Weeden, technical analyst with the Secure World Foundation.

Gen. William Shelton, commander of Air Force Space Command, disclosed the previously secret Geosynchronous Space Situational Awareness Program, or GSSAP, at a conference in Orlando last month.

"GSSAP will bolster our ability to discern when adversaries attempt to avoid detection and to discover capabilities they may have, which might be harmful to our critical assets at these higher altitudes," Shelton said, according to an Air Force report.

Details about the design and cost of the satellites built by Orbital Sciences Corp. were not discussed. The second pair is expected to launch in 2016.

Shelton said the program was made public as a deterrent. The hope is that if other countries know these spacecraft are up there, they might be less inclined to consider an aggressive move.

U.S. military spacecraft in that region of space — including some whose existence are not publicly acknowledged — provide early warnings of rocket and missile launches, collect intelligence, and would provide secure communications during a nuclear conflict.

Although the new program was a surprise, Weeden said, the Air Force has long expressed concern about the need for better "situational awareness" to protect these increasingly important space-based capabilities.

The use of satellites to study what other spacecraft are doing also isn't new.

Small experimental U.S. satellites reportedly inspected a missile warning satellite that had failed for unknown reasons in 2008.

As far back as 1967, U.S. spacecraft took pictures of the Soviet Union's lunar landing system during orbital tests, said Charles Vick, senior analyst with GlobalSecurity.org.

"This kind of thing, to protect ourselves against other nations' potential intentions, it's just a modernized version, a much more up-to-date and real-time kind of thing," said Vick.

Public disclosure of the new program was unusual, he said, "but I guess they realized somebody could figure it out."

Satellites in geostationary orbit circle the planet at the same speed at which the Earth rotates, so appear fixed in the sky.

To see what's operating in the geostationary belt around the equator, the new Air Force spacecraft will fly slightly lower or higher, thus moving a bit faster or slower and from side to side, to eventually drift past everything.

Other satellites aren't the only potential threats; orbital debris could also cause a disabling collision, though it's a bigger problem in lower orbits.

Only about 436 of 1,400 objects now being tracked in or near geosynchronous orbits are actively controlled satellites.

Space debris smaller than 10 centimeters cannot now be tracked reliably, but the new satellites could help.

Weeden said there has been no known attempt by one satellite to attack another. Speculation over decades has imagined a variety of ways that might be accomplished, from one satellite poking a hole in another's fuel tank, to parking in front of it to block its view, to setting off explosives.

Given limited information, it's hard to know how serious the threat is.

"Maybe China or Russia is doing something that we don't know about, but it's more likely the Air Force is being overly cautious," he said.

Some countries may worry the GSSAP satellites are capable of aggressive acts, a suspicion likely to grow if the U.S. is not transparent about their operations, Weeden said.

He thinks calling them spy satellites, however, is a stretch.

"Spying connotes that it's somehow malicious or bad," he said. "This is just collecting more information. It's intelligence."

Falcon 9 rocket moves closer to certification by Air Force
BY STEPHEN CLARK
SPACEFLIGHT NOW

March 3, 2014

The first launch of SpaceX's upgraded Falcon 9 rocket in September will count as one of the three successful flights to certify the launcher to carry the U.S. military's most valuable payloads into orbit, despite a glitch with the rocket's upper stage engine during a demonstration maneuver after deployment of a Canadian research payload, the Air Force announced last week.


Photo of the Falcon 9 rocket's Sept. 29, 2013, launch from Vandenberg Air Force Base, Calif. Photo credit: SpaceX
 
The Air Force's decision moves SpaceX closer to competing to launch the military's most expensive and vital communications, missile warning, navigation and intelligence satellites.

SpaceX would join incumbent contractor United Launch Alliance, which operates the Atlas 5 and Delta 4 rockets for the Air Force's Evolved Expendable Launch Vehicle program.

The Air Force is seeking reduced-cost launch options in the wake of rising prices for launch services in recent years. Officials have targeted some of the blame for spiraling costs on the retirement of the space shuttle and the cancellation of NASA's Constellation moon program, now replaced with the heavy-lift Space Launch System and Orion crew capsule in development for human missions beyond low Earth orbit.

The Sept. 29 launch of the Falcon 9 v1.1 rocket was the debut flight of SpaceX's new-generation satellite launcher, featuring more powerful Merlin 1D engines, a simplified stage separation system with three connecting points instead of 12, a triple-redundant flight computer, and new software.

The maiden flight of the Falcon 9 v1.1 delivered Canada's Cassiope satellite into a polar orbit to conduct space weather research and communications relay experiments.

SpaceX considered the Sept. 29 launch a test flight, and engineers tried to relight the Falcon 9's upper stage Merlin 1D engine after releasing Cassiope into orbit.

But the rocket's on-board computer aborted the engine restart.

SpaceX officials said engineers traced the problem to lines feeding igniter fluid into the engine's thrust chamber. Between the engine burns, the lines froze from exposure to cryogenic liquid oxygen, which the Merlin engine consumes along with kerosene fuel stored at warm temperatures.

The Air Force Space Command's Space and Missile Systems Center is still assessing two subsequent Falcon 9 launches Dec. 3 and Jan. 6, but those missions successfully put their commercial telecom payloads into orbit without any problems.


The Falcon 9 rocket's upper stage Merlin 1D engine as seen from an on-board video camera. Photo credit: SpaceX
 
SpaceX and the Air Force signed a Cooperative Research and Development Agreement in June 2013, setting conditions before the Air Force permits the company to compete for launch contracts for the military's most critical satellites.

"This flight represents one of many certification requirements jointly agreed to between the Air Force and SpaceX," said Lt. Gen. Ellen Pawlikowski, SMC commander at Los Angeles Air Force Base, Calif.

The agreement calls for three successful flights of a common launch vehicle configuration, technical reviews, audits and independent verification, and validation of the launch vehicle's ground systems and manufacturing processes, according to the Air Force.

"Where possible, the Air Force will work jointly with SpaceX to accelerate completing the requirements from these phases to expedite certification," the Air Force said in a statement.

SpaceX currently assembles Falcon 9 rockets with their payloads horizontally, then rolls the rocket to the launch pad before erecting it on top of the launch mount. Company officials have said they will adjust their procedures to accommodate the military's requirement to integrate national security payloads in a vertical orientation.

"We plan to accommodate vertical integration at out launch pads for any Air Force mission that requires it, and we'll make the necessary modifications at our own expense," a SpaceX spokesperson said last year.

An Air Force spokesperson said national security spacecraft are currently not designed for horizontal integration.

"The EELV program is required to provide a common interface so spacecraft do not require re-design in order to move to a different EELV launch vehicle," the Air Force spokesperson said. "All current and future EELV launch vehicles are required to comply with this standard interface."

The Hawthorne, Calif.-based space transportation company could offer the Air Force $1 billion in launch cost savings per year, according to SpaceX spokesperson Emily Shanklin.

While ULA and the Air Force signed a sole-source deal for 36 Atlas 5 and Delta 4 rocket cores to guarantee access to space for military payloads, the service identified 14 missions to open up to competition with SpaceX once the Falcon 9 rocket is certified.

WASHINGTON — Space Exploration Technologies Corp. moved a step closer to being allowed to bid for U.S. national security launch contracts with the Air Force announcing that the Sept. 29 debut of the company's Falcon 9 v1.1 rocket will count as the first of three required successes despite SpaceX's failure to reignite the rocket's upper-stage engine following deployment of its satellite payload. 

The Air Force's formal certification of Falcon 9 v1.1's maiden launch was announced Feb. 25. The upgraded rocket has launched twice since it debuted last September carrying Canada's Cassiope space weather satellite and three secondary payloads to low Earth orbit. SpaceX successfully delivered the SES-8 telecommunications satellite to geostationary transfer orbit Dec. 3 and followed with a successful Jan. 6 launch of the Thaicom-6 satellite. The Air Force is still evaluating those flights, although Air Force leaders have said they do not expect problems.

As part of its Evolved Expendable Launch Vehicle program, the Air Force is negotiating the purchase of up to 36 rocket cores over five years from market incumbent United Launch Alliance of Denver. The service plans to competitively award an additional 14 missions to give new entrants such as SpaceX a chance to break into the market. Under the Air Force's so-called New Entrant Certification Guide used to vet competitors in the launch business, companies are expected to complete three successful launches of their rockets, including at least two consecutively. The rocket also must pass technical reviews and audits of the launch vehicle, ground systems and manufacturing processes. [6 Fun Facts about SpaceX]

"[The Sept. 29] flight represents one of many certification requirements jointly agreed to between the Air Force and SpaceX," Lt. Gen. Ellen Pawlikowski, commander of the Space and Missile Systems Center at Los Angeles Air Force Base, said in a Feb. 25 press release.

Meanwhile, SpaceX Chief Executive Elon Musk and United Launch Alliance Chief Executive Michael Gass are slated to testify side by side March 5 at a Senate Appropriations defense subcommittee hearing on national security space launch programs. Senators are expected to ask about the structure of the competition, savings on a recent deal between the Air Force and ULA on the first batch of rockets in the block buy, and the EELV contract structure under which ULA receives two separate lines of funding: one for launch vehicles and related services and one for launch capability funding.

Editor's note: In an open letter obtained by NBC's Jay Barbree, former astronauts Neil Armstrong, James Lovell  and Eugene Cernan urge President Obama to reconsider what they warn would be "devastating" new policies for the future of NASA.

The United States entered into the challenge of space exploration under President Eisenhower's first term, however, it was the Soviet Union who excelled in those early years.  Under the bold vision of Presidents Kennedy, Johnson, and Nixon, and with the overwhelming approval of the American people, we rapidly closed the gap in the final third; of the 20th century, and became the world leader in space exploration.

America's space accomplishments earned the respect and admiration of the world. Science probes were unlocking the secrets of the cosmos; space technology was providing instantaneous worldwide communication; orbital sentinels were helping man understand the vagaries of nature.  Above all else, the people around the world were inspired by the human exploration of space and the expanding of man's frontier.  It suggested that what had been thought to be impossible was now within reach. Students were inspired to prepare themselves to be a part of this new age.  No government program in modern history has been so effective in motivating the young to do "what has never been done before." 
  
World leadership in space was not achieved easily.  In the first half-century of the space age, our country made a significant financial investment, thousands of Americans dedicated themselves to the effort, and some gave their lives to achieve the dream of a nation.  In the latter part of the first half century of the space age, Americans and their international partners focused primarily on exploiting the near frontiers of space with the Space Shuttle and the International Space Station. 
  
As a result of the tragic loss of the Space Shuttle Columbia in 2003, it was concluded that our space policy required a new strategic vision. Extensive studies and analysis led to this new mandate: meet our existing commitments, return to our exploration roots, return to the moon, and prepare to venture further outward to the asteroids and to Mars.  The program was named "Constellation."  In the ensuing years, this plan was endorsed by two Presidents of different parties and approved by both Democratic and Republican congresses. 
  
The Columbia Accident Board had given NASA a number of recommendations fundamental to the Constellation architecture which were duly incorporated.  The Ares rocket family was patterned after the Von Braun Modular concept so essential to the success of the Saturn 1B and the Saturn 5.   A number of components in the Ares 1 rocket would become the foundation of the very large heavy lift Ares V, thus reducing the total development costs substantially.  After the Ares 1 becomes operational, the only major new components necessary for the Ares V would be the larger propellant tanks to support the heavy lift requirements. 

The design and the production of the flight components and infrastructure to implement this vision was well underway.  Detailed planning of all the major sectors of the program had begun.  Enthusiasm within NASA and throughout the country was very high. 
  
When President Obama recently released his budget for NASA, he proposed a slight increase in total funding, substantial research and technology development, an extension of the International Space Station operation until 2020, long range planning for a new but undefined heavy lift rocket and significant funding for the development of commercial access to low earth orbit.

Although some of these proposals have merit,  the accompanying decision to cancel the Constellation program, its Ares 1 and Ares V rockets, and the Orion spacecraft, is devastating.

America's only path to low Earth orbit and the International Space Station will now be subject to an agreement with Russia to purchase space on their Soyuz  (at a price of over 50 million dollars per seat with significant increases expected in the near future) until we have the capacity to provide transportation for ourselves.   The availability of a commercial transport to orbit as envisioned in the President's proposal cannot be predicted with any certainty, but is likely to take substantially longer and be more expensive than we would hope.  

It appears that we will have wasted our current $10-plus billion investment in Constellation and, equally importantly, we will have lost the many years required to recreate the equivalent of what we will have discarded. 
  
For The United States, the leading space faring nation for nearly half a century, to be without carriage to low Earth orbit and with no human exploration capability to go beyond Earth orbit for an indeterminate time into the future, destines our nation to become one of second or even third rate stature.  While the President's plan envisages humans traveling away from Earth and perhaps toward Mars at some time in the future, the lack of developed rockets and spacecraft will assure that ability will not be available for many years.

Without the skill and experience that actual spacecraft operation provides, the USA is far too likely to be on a long downhill slide to mediocrity.  America must decide if it wishes to remain a leader in space.  If it does, we should institute a program which will give us the very best chance of achieving that goal.

Neil Armstrong 
Commander, Apollo 11

James Lovell 
Commander, Apollo 13

Eugene Cernan 
Commander, Apollo 17

REAL Space Act of 2013 wrote: "http://www.foxnews.com/scitech/2011/07/06/shuttle-veterans-fight-to-delay-spacecrafts-retirement/ Shuttle Veterans Fight to Delay Spacecraft's Retirement CAPE CANAVERAL, Fla. – First moonwalker Neil Armstrong, first American in orbit John Glenn, Mission Control founder Chris Kraft, Apollo 13 commander Jim Lovell, first shuttle pilot Robert Crippen and others are pushing for a last minute reprieve for the about-to-be-retired space shuttle fleet. They're even urging a delay of Friday's final launch. They may get a delay of a day or two because of bad weather. But the NASA veterans are looking for a pause of more than a year, until more shuttle parts are ready to keep flying and extend the 30-year program. Back in June, as Atlantis headed to the launch pad, launch director Mike Leinbach on a live audio loop groused to his fellow workers "we're all victims of poor policy out of Washington, D.C.," for not having a new mission for the post-shuttle era. Glenn, who returned to space at the age of 77 by flying on the shuttle Discovery in 1998, said: "I told the president, 'We're violating one of NASA's critical design criteria."' That means there must be a backup system for getting into space and bringing astronauts home from the International Space Station. Armstrong, Kraft and Lovell sent a letter June 30 to President Barack Obama and NASA chief Charles Bolden asking that they keep shuttles flying and delay this final launch. Glenn, who wasn't involved in the letter campaign, is also calling it a mistake to end the space shuttle program -- planned since 2004. Kraft said he considered a backup crucial as he ran Mission Control or oversaw the people who did -- missions from the Mercury days of the 1960s through early space shuttle days. He said it is still possible at this late date to put Atlantis' final mission on hold while NASA builds new external fuel tanks and boosters for future shuttle flights -- a process that would delay the launch about 18 months. "It's a generational thing. It's a culture thing and mostly it's a political thing," said Kraft, 87. Nearly all the signees of the letter are in their 70s and 80s. Glenn, who didn't sign the letter, will turn 90 this month. It's a fight Kraft has waged for at least three years, pulling in Armstrong, 80, and others. Armstrong, in an email to The Associated Press, wrote: "Chris is an exceptional engineer and manager who has always been reliable in the many cases where he held the success or failure of American human space flight in his hands." He wrote that if Kraft thinks this is too risky a plan, "I can readily accept that." For his part, NASA Administrator Bolden, a former shuttle commander, defended the shuttle retirentury approach: "This is a century with new challenges and also new opportunities." Scott Parazynski, a 49-year-old former astronaut who heads the educational center created by Challenger families, said in an email that he agrees with Kraft that NASA shouldn't be left without a backup to the Soyuz, but disagrees with the idea of delaying the shuttle retirement. "The cards have been dealt, and even though we may not all like the cards we've gotten, we've got to play," Parazynski wrote. "I see a path forward that gives American industry (new enterprise as well as established aerospace) and NASA a bright future." The American public apparently wants the U.S. to continue to be a space leader. According to a poll by the Pew Research Center released Tuesday, 58 percent of Americans think it's essential the nation continue as a leader in space. For his part, Glenn said he doesn't disagree with Obama's plans, although he said he believes private spaceflight will take years longer than Bolden predicts. What Glenn objects to is the gap between the shuttle and a future spacecraft. While the Soyuz is reliable, Glenn said NASA should always want an alternative in case of a "hiccup" in the Soyuz plans. "I think we should be keeping the shuttle going," Glenn said. "It's the most complicated vehicle ever put together by people.""
